Terra Metals’ Dante Reefs has potential to be a globally significant source of commercially attractive products

March 25, 2025 04:13 PM AEDT | By Team Kalkine Media
 Terra Metals’ Dante Reefs has potential to be a globally significant source of commercially attractive products
Image source: shutterstock

Highlights:

  • Dante Reefs project has produced three distinct high-grade concentrates using low-cost processing methods.

  • The project demonstrates a strong presence of copper, gold, PGMs, vanadium, and titanium.

  • Phase two metallurgical test work is currently in progress, with a maiden resource estimate planned.

Terra Metals Ltd (ASX:TM1, OTC:PNGZF) continues to develop its Dante Reefs project, focusing on the production of high-grade concentrates through effective and cost-efficient metallurgical processes. The company has successfully produced three concentrates, highlighting the presence of key commercial materials.

Metallurgical testing has applied simple processing techniques, including flotation and magnetic separation, to extract multiple products from a single deposit. The use of these established methods demonstrates the efficiency of the Dante Reefs project.

Composition of High-Grade Concentrates

The Dante Reefs deposit has yielded three separate concentrates, each rich in valuable materials. One concentrate contains copper, gold, and platinum group metals (PGMs), meeting industry standards for commercial viability. Another consists of vanadium, which has been efficiently separated using magnetic processing, while the third is a titanium-rich ilmenite concentrate.

Future Development Plans

Terra Metals Ltd is progressing to the next stage of its metallurgical test work. The company aims to refine concentrate grades further while optimizing recovery rates. Additionally, a maiden resource estimate is being prepared based on extensive drilling completed in the past year.

Phase two testing will focus on enhancing process efficiency, ensuring that the Dante Reefs project maintains its position as a contributor to the resource sector.
